首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
在考生文件夹下,打开学生数据库sdb,完成如下简单应用: (1)使用报表向导建立一个简单报表。要求选择student表中所有字段:记录不分组;报表样式为“随意式”:列数为“1”,字段布局为“列”,方向为“纵向”;排序字段为“学号”(升序):报表标题
在考生文件夹下,打开学生数据库sdb,完成如下简单应用: (1)使用报表向导建立一个简单报表。要求选择student表中所有字段:记录不分组;报表样式为“随意式”:列数为“1”,字段布局为“列”,方向为“纵向”;排序字段为“学号”(升序):报表标题
admin
2013-03-31
57
问题
在考生文件夹下,打开学生数据库sdb,完成如下简单应用:
(1)使用报表向导建立一个简单报表。要求选择student表中所有字段:记录不分组;报表样式为“随意式”:列数为“1”,字段布局为“列”,方向为“纵向”;排序字段为“学号”(升序):报表标题为“学生基本情况一览表”;报表文件名为two。
(2)使用查询设计器设计一个查询,查询每个班级的“班级号”、“班级名”、“班长名”和“班主任名”,查询结果按“班级号”升序排序,并输出到one表中。运行该查询,并将设计的查询保存为one.qpr文件。注意:
①表之间的关联,一个是student表的“学号”与class表的“班长号”,另一个是class表的“班主任号”与teacher表的“教师号”。
②查询结果的各列的名称分别为“班级号”、“班级名”、“班长名”和“班主任名”。“班长名”列的数据来自于student表的“姓名”,“班主任名”列的数据来自于teacher表的“教师名”。
选项
答案
(1)步骤1:在命令窗口执行命令:
OPEN DATABASE sdb
,打开sdb数据库环境。 步骤2:执行【文件】→【新建】菜单命令,或单击“常用”工具栏的“新建”按钮,在弹出的“新建”对话框中选中“报表”选项,然后单击“向导”图标按钮,系统弹出“向导选取”对话框,选中“报表向导”项,单击“确定”按钮,启动报表向导。 步骤3:在报表向导的“步骤1-字段选取”界面的“数据库和表”下选中“STUDENT”表,将“可用字段”中的字段添加到“选定字段”中,单击“下一步”按钮。 步骤4:跳过“步骤2-分组记录”界面继续单击“下一步”按钮。 步骤5:在报表向导的“步骤3-选择报表样式”界面中选中“样式”列表中的“随意式”,单击“下一步”按钮。 步骤6:在报表向导的“步骤4-定义报表布局”界面中设置“列数”为“1”,“字段布局”为“列”,选择“方向”为“纵向”,单击“下一步”按钮。 步骤7:在报表向导的“步骤5-排序记录”界面中双击 “可用的字段或索引标识”中的“学号”字段到“选定字段” 列表中,单击“下一步”按钮。 步骤8:在报表向导的“步骤6-完成”界面的“报表标题”文本框中输入“学生基本情况一览表”,单击“完成”按钮,在“另存为”对话框的“保存报表为:”框中输入报表文件名two,单击“保存”按钮。 (2)步骤1:在命令窗口执行命令:
OPEN DATABASE sdb
,打开数据库环境。 步骤2:在命令窗口执行命令:
CREATE QUERY one
,打开查询设计器,在“添加表或视图”对话框中,分别双击 “teacher”表、“class”表和“student”表(注意一定要按顺序添加表),将表添加到查询设计器中,此时,添加的表会按照数据库中已存在的表间联系自动为3个表在查询设计器中建立联系。 步骤3:根据题目要求,此时要修改“student”表和"class”表之间的默认联系。双击“student”表和“class”,表之间的连线,系统弹出“联接条件”对话框,在显示“class.班级号”的下拉框中选择“class.班长号”,在显示“student.班级号”的下拉框中选择“student.学号”,单击“确定”按钮保存修改。 步骤4:依次双击“class”表中的“班级号”和“班级名”字段,添加到“字段”选项卡的“选定字段”列表中;然后在“字段”选项卡的“函数和表达式”下的文本框中输入表达式:student.姓名 as班长名,再单击“添加”按钮,将其添加到“选定字段”列表中:以同样的方法再向“选定字段”列表中添加一个表达式:teacher.教师名 as班主任名。 步骤5:执行【查询】→【查询去向】菜单命令,在弹出的“查询去向”对话框中单击“表”图标按钮,接着在“表名”中输入文件名one,单击“确定”按钮。 步骤6:最后单击“常用”工具栏中的“运行”按钮查看结果,将查询文件保存到考生文件夹下。
解析
(1)本题考查的是报表向导的使用,操作前可以将数据库环境打开,这样在报表向导的“步骤1-字段选取”界面中可直接看到作为报表数据源的表,之后按照向导提示完成题目所要求的设置即可。
(2)本题主要考查的查询设计器的使用,首先要判断查询数据源包括哪些数据表,将数据表添加到查询设计器后,再根据题目要求从每个表中选取字段,设置查询条件等完成查询。本题操作的关键有3点:
首先是3个表的添加顺序,要按照“teacher”表、“class”表和“student”表的顺序进行添加,否则会导致两个表之间无法建立联系,或是导致查询出错。
其次,由于数据库中已存在表之间的联系,在添加数据库表到查询设计器中的时候,会将表之间的联系也一起进行到查询设计器中,而本题中根据题目的要求需要改变这种联系,因此,注意修改表间默认的联系。
最后是字段的重命名,根据题目要求最终输出的字段包括“班长名”和“班主任名”,因此需要利用AS短语对原本输出的“student.姓名”和“teacher.教师名”重新命名。
转载请注明原文地址:https://kaotiyun.com/show/Musp777K
本试题收录于:
二级VF题库NCRE全国计算机二级分类
0
二级VF
NCRE全国计算机二级
相关试题推荐
设工资=1200,职称=“教授”,下列逻辑表达式的值是【】。工资>1000AND(职称="教授"OR职称="副教授")
在SQL语言中,CREATEVIEW语句用于建立视图。如果要求对视图更新时必须满足子查询中的条件表达式,应当在该语句中使用短语______。
在查找过程中,若同时还要做插入、删除操作,这种查找称为______。
数据库是指按照一定的规则存储在计算机中的【】的集合,它能被各种用户共享。
软件生命周期一般可分为以下阶段:问题定义、可行性研究、【】、设计、编码、测试、运行与维护。
2.在数据结构中,用一组地址连续的存储单元一次存储数据元素的方式是【】结构。
在VisualFoxPro中主索引字段
视图设计器中包含的选项卡有
在关系数据库的基本操作中,从表中取出满足条件元组的操作称为【】。
SQL语句中修改表结构的命令是_________。
随机试题
中国共产党是中国工人阶级的先锋队,同时又是中国人民和中华民族的先锋队,“两个先锋队”是不可分割的统一整体,两者的关系是()
惊厥持续状态是指惊厥时间
丙酸在反刍动物体内主要用于
患儿,男,3岁。麻疹见疹已6日,高热不退,咳嗽气急,鼻翼扇动,口渴烦躁,舌红苔黄,脉数。其证型是
根据《建设工程勘察设计管理条例》,编制施工图设计文件应满足的要求是()I.满足设备材料采购的需要Ⅱ.满足非标准设备制作和施工的需要Ⅲ.注明建设工程合理使用年限Ⅳ.满足工程招标的需要
腾飞公司2008年12月份有关损益类科目的发生额如下:若该公司执行的企业所得税税率为25%。请根据上述资料回答以下各题:腾飞公司2008年12月的所得税费用为()元。
平面设计师程某为一公司设计了一个平面广告,取得设计收入23000元。则程某应缴纳个人所得税的下列计算中,正确的是()。
指导城市居民委员会建设,制定社区工作及社区服务管理办法和促进发展的政策措施,推动社区建设,这属于()在社会福利方面的职能。
残缺家庭是指家庭中配偶一方因离婚、死亡、出走、分居等原因使家庭成员不全的家庭。在现代西方国家,离婚率较高,造成残缺家庭数量增多。以美国为例,20世纪70年代以来,每两对登记结婚的夫妇中就有一对离婚,单亲家庭数量增加75%以上。离婚后,由于男子的再婚机会多于
Readinginvolveslookingatgraphicsymbolsandformulatingmentallythesoundsandideastheyrepresent.Conceptsofreadingha
最新回复
(
0
)